What Are Dental Implants? A Brief Overview

Before diving into the selection process, it’s essential to understand what dental implants are and why they are so beneficial.

What is a Dental Implant?

A dental implant is a titanium post that is surgically placed into the jawbone to replace a missing tooth root. Over time, the bone fuses with the implant in a process called osseointegration, making the implant a permanent fixture. Once the implant is stable, a crown, bridge, or denture can be placed on top to restore the appearance and function of the missing tooth or teeth.

Why Choose Dental Implants?

Dental implants offer a variety of benefits compared to other restorative options such as dentures or bridges:

  • Long-term Solution: Dental implants are designed to last for many years, sometimes even a lifetime with proper care.
  • Improved Functionality: Implants function just like natural teeth, allowing for improved biting and chewing abilities.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: Implants look and feel like natural teeth, making them an excellent choice for those concerned about their appearance.
  • Bone Health: Implants help prevent bone loss, a common issue that arises when teeth are missing.
  • Enhanced Confidence: With implants, you don’t have to worry about loose dentures or gaps in your smile.

Key Qualifications to Look for in a Dental Implant Specialist

Choosing the right dental implant specialist requires you to evaluate several key qualifications. These qualifications are essential to ensuring that your procedure is performed safely and effectively.

Board Certification and Specialization

One of the first things you should check when choosing a dental implant specialist is whether they are board-certified. In the U.S., dental professionals can earn board certification in oral and maxillofacial surgery or periodontics—two specialties that are highly relevant to dental implants. Board certification means the specialist has undergone extensive training and has passed rigorous exams, ensuring a high level of expertise.

  • Oral Surgeons: Oral and maxillofacial surgeons specialize in surgeries related to the mouth, jaw, and face. They are often the preferred choice for complex dental implant surgeries.
  • Periodontists: Periodontists are experts in the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of gum disease. They also specialize in placing dental implants, particularly in cases where gum health is a concern.

Experience and Expertise in Implant Dentistry

Experience is critical when it comes to dental implants. A highly experienced implant specialist will have a deeper understanding of the procedure and potential complications. Ideally, the specialist should have a significant number of successful dental implant cases under their belt.

  • Years in Practice: Look for specialists with several years of experience in implant dentistry.
  • Types of Implants: An experienced specialist should be familiar with various types of implants (single tooth implants, multiple implants, full-mouth restoration, etc.).
  • Success Rates: Ask about their success rates with dental implants and whether they can provide testimonials or case studies.

Comprehensive Treatment Approach

A good dental implant specialist should offer a comprehensive treatment plan. This involves not just placing the implant, but also assessing your oral health, discussing different implant options, and preparing you for the recovery process. The treatment approach should be personalized to your specific needs and involve thorough consultations.

  • Initial Consultation: The specialist should perform a thorough examination, which may include X-rays, CT scans, and other diagnostic tests to assess bone density and structure.
  • Post-Procedure Care: Inquire about the post-operative care plan. A skilled implant specialist will provide clear instructions for care after surgery, as well as follow-up appointments to monitor healing.

Technology and Facilities

Modern dental implant procedures often require advanced technology to ensure precision and success. A reputable dental implant specialist should use state-of-the-art equipment, such as:

  • 3D Imaging: Helps create accurate treatment plans and allows the surgeon to visualize the bone structure in detail.
  • Laser Technology: Minimizes discomfort and speeds up recovery by using lasers instead of traditional surgical tools.
  • Computer-Guided Surgery: A computer-assisted tool that helps the surgeon place the implant with greater accuracy and predictability.

Cost of Dental Implants

Dental implants are a significant financial investment, so understanding the cost is essential. The total cost of the procedure can vary widely based on factors such as:

  • Location of the Specialist: Specialists in large cities or metropolitan areas may charge higher fees.
  • Complexity of the Procedure: If you require additional procedures such as bone grafting or sinus lifts, this can add to the cost.
  • Insurance: Many dental insurance plans may partially cover the cost of dental implants. Be sure to check if the specialist accepts your insurance and whether they offer payment plans.

Questions to Ask Before Choosing a Dental Implant Specialist

It’s crucial to have an open discussion with your potential implant specialist to ensure they are the right fit for you. Here are some important questions to ask during your consultation:

What is Your Experience with Dental Implants?

Ask the specialist how many dental implant procedures they have performed, as well as their success rate. It’s also helpful to ask about their experience with the type of implant you need.

Can You Provide Patient Testimonials or Before-and-After Photos?

Patient testimonials and before-and-after images will help you get a clearer understanding of the outcomes you can expect.

What Are the Risks and Complications?

Every surgical procedure comes with risks. A skilled implant specialist should be able to discuss the potential risks of dental implants, such as infection or implant failure, and explain how they mitigate those risks.

How Long Will the Recovery Process Take?

Recovery times vary depending on the complexity of the procedure and your overall health. Ask about the recovery process and any restrictions you may have after surgery.

Do You Offer a Guarantee or Warranty?

Some implant specialists offer guarantees on their work or provide warranties on the implants themselves. This can give you peace of mind that your investment is protected.
